How to Make Warm Crack Chicken Dip

This Warm Crack Chicken Dip is super easy to make. My number one tip is to use rotisserie chicken for the cooked chicken in the recipe. Rotisserie chicken is my secret weapon in my kitchen. I always have bags of pulled rotisserie chicken in the freezer for quick recipes like this one.

To make the dip, combine cream cheese, sour cream, chicken, ranch dressing mix, bacon, and cheddar cheese. SUPER easy! Pop it in the oven and you are minutes away from some seriously delicious dip.

If you are looking to cut back on the calories in this dip, feel free to use low-fat cream cheese, low-fat sour cream, and turkey bacon. I haven’t tried this dip with plain Greek yogurt, but I am sure it would still taste great!

Ingredients:

  • 1 (8-oz) package cream cheese, softened
  • 1 (1-oz) package ranch dressing mix
  • 1 cup chopped cooked bacon
  • 2 cups sh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1 (16-oz) container sour cream
  • 2 cups chopped cooked chicken

Instructions:

  • Preheat the oven to 400ºF. Spray a 2-qt baking dish with cooking spray. Set aside.
  • In a bowl, combine all ingredients, mixing well. Transfer to prepared dish.
  • Bake uncovered for 25 to 30 minutes, until hot and bubbly.

Notes:

Can assemble dip ahead of time and refrigerate until serving. When baking after refrigerating you may need to add a few minutes to the cooking time. Can use chopped precooked bacon.
